Near Distant by Michelle Lou explores the intricate interplay of stasis, time and perception. Lou’s compositions challenge conventional interpretations, presenting music as a constantly evolving landscape. Through “static” or “stasis-variation” she reveals the complexity within seemingly unchanging sounds, inviting listeners to explore subtle transformations in pitch, timbre and dynamics. This album embodies Lou’s unique approach, emphasizing our active role in perceiving and transforming the infinite essence of music.
